TCAF events with Alice

While I am working on Quinntessential Comix behind the scenes I have been very active with events in the Toronto Comics Community. Last Month I organized and hosted Ladies Night at the Comic Book Lounge and I am very excited to co-host two events just before TCAF this Friday May 10th! 

Magical Toronto Comic Shop Tour
Friday May 10 begins at 12pm at The Beguiling.
I’m very excited to co-host this comic hot spot tour with the Shanahanigans. If you don’t know the dynamo writer/artist brother/sister combo you have excellent stuff to check out firstly Silly Kingdom a wonderful all ages comic. As well you should tune into Katie & Shaggy’s popular live show on Google+ Thursdays @ 8pm EST “ShanahanigansLIVE” or archived on YouTube

ANYWAY This event is designed for people visiting Toronto for TCAF we are hitting up all the comic shop hot spots we could fit in an afternoon & will regale Toronto trivia and fun anecdotes along the way. Of Course if you have the afternoon off & live in the city you could join us & let us get you pumped for the TCAF weekend! I haven’t invited many people to this event because the people usually on my FB invite lists have been to all these places & live in the city so I’m inviting YOU! Yeah that’s right personal invite right there RSVP on the FB so we know who to expect. It is going to be a rather small group but a super fun time! If you are not able to make it right away we’ll be live tweeting our progress along the tour, be sure to follow us on twitter: @shaggyshan @ktshy @TheAliceQuinn

The Political Comics of Matt Bors
Friday May 10 7-10 pm @ The Comic Book Lounge & Gallery 

I am delighted to co-host this event alongside Nicole Marie Guiniling of the blog Ad Astra Comix, Nicole is a talented comics researcher and we are currently collaborating on QCX Introduction Series. Nicole set up this whole event, she has an avid interest with political comics which has in turn intrigued me. When she asked if I would interview Bors live at the event I jumped at the opportunity and I’m delighted to be involved and record the interview for the QCX YouTube Channel

I’m really excited to interview Matt Bors and see the presentation he has planned for us! Bors posts political commentary in comic from a few times a week on his website mattbors.com many of which appear in The Sacramento Bee, Portland Mercury, Pittsburgh City Paper, and Daily Kos. His work has earned him many awards including being a Finalist for the Pulitzer Prize in 2012!

In my biased opinion these two events are a fantastic way to kick off your TCAF weekend! Hope to see you there :D
